Theory of the ring cyclotron
A.P. Fateev-1962-01-01-Journal of Nuclear Energy Part C Plasma Physics Accelerators Thermonuclear Research
0
TL;DRAbstract
An attempt is made to demonstrate the existence of stable, closed orbits, considering edge effects. Special attention is given to symmetry variation in which acceleration, accumulation, and beam front interaction are taking place. The results are used in an investigation of various ring cyclotron modifications. (R.V.J.)
